Which is better, iced latte or iced macchiato?
Creaminess: Opt for an iced latte if you prefer a creamier, slightly sweet beverage with more milk. Caffeine boost: Select an iced macchiato for a higher caffeine content, as it typically contains two shots of espresso. Milk preference: Pick an iced latte if you enjoy a larger amount of cold milk in your coffee. What’s the difference between iced mocha and iced macchiato?
In mocha, the milk is first steamed at medium heat. Once the milk is steamed, it is added in the mixture that contains espresso and chocolate. Meanwhile, in a macchiato, only foamy milk is added on top of the espresso which is prepared using a milk frother. How many calories are in a Dunkin’ Donuts iced macchiato? A medium iced macchiato at Dunkin’ has about 120 calories. What are the calories for a Dunkin’ Donuts iced macchiato with almond milk? The iced macchiato with almond milk has around 80 calories.
